Environments — Calsync Conflict Notes (Harloft Scheduler). Quick heads-up for the sync: staging and prod are pointing Calsync at the same conflict-resolution queue again, which is why Demi saw duplicate meeting rewrites last Thursday. Prod should win ties; staging should dry-run only. We split the queues on Monday and added an env guard so this can't silently recur. For reference, each environment's resolver settings are listed below:

config for bahop-fajep:
DRUATH_PIN=4501
DRUATH_TENANT=briwyn
DRUATH_METRICS_HOST=metrics.druath.brasksoft.test
DRUATH_SEAL=seal_7d2e069d
DRUATH_STANDBY_TEAM=olieth

Subject: Quickstore 4.2 — bloom filter now fronts the KV layer

Plugin authors: starting with this release, Quickstore places a bloom filter ahead of the key-value store. Negative lookups return faster; false positives fall through safely. No API changes are required on your side. Verify your plugin against the staging build referenced below.

session token of fahif-tadup = htk3_9c7

**Vendor note: Inkmill markdown pipeline**

Rendering for Parchway docs is outsourced to Inkmill under an annual contract, renewing each March. They handle sanitization and PDF export; we own the upload queue. SLA: 4-hour response on rendering failures. Escalate only after two failed retries. Their support desk is reachable at the address below.

billing contact of hahaf-baguf = zorael.tammir.jorius@sivrelhq.internal

- [ ] Step 7: Archive cold storage buckets (Glacierline tier). Confirm both ceremony witnesses are present, verify bucket manifests match the Oxbow ledger, then seal the archive key shares. Plugin authors may observe but not handle shares. Once sealed, the archive index itself is encrypted and can only be reopened with the passphrase below.

vault phrase of badup-hahig = tamael-aldael-kelmir-istael-fenok-istwyn-tamius-jorath-oliion